Swaybox Studios is seeking a CG Generalist Sets Lead to spearhead and support the Unreal pre and post production needs of our VFX team. This role is hands-on and highly collaborative, requiring technical excellence and creative problem-solving to help bring complex visual effects to lifefrom full CG environments to set extensions. As a CG Generalist Sets Supervisor, you will provide support in early R&D, guide visual development setups, assist with troubleshooting artist files, and participate in broader production efforts, including bidding and recruiting. Your expertise will help shape and refine the technical pipeline while fostering a collaborative and efficient team environment. Key Responsibilities: Lead and support all Unreal/CG-related work across VFX production. Contribute to the creation of CG environments and set extensions, using scans, models, and photogrammetry. Utilizing skillset in creating and adjusting materials, lighting, and rendering. Troubleshoot artist files and step into shot work when needed. Collaborate in R&D and early visual development before full production rollout. Support the development and implementation of tools in collaboration with TDs. Participate in recruitment and progress reviews with the VFX Supervisor and Production. Ensure an efficient, flexible, and artist-friendly pipeline, while maintaining organized files and documentation. Required Qualifications: Minimum 5+ years of experience in high-end film or episodic VFX production. Expert knowledge of Unreal. Previous leadership or supervisor experience within a VFX or animation team. Thorough understanding of CG modeling and rigging workflows. Artistic eye and proficiency in UVs, shading, texture, lighting, and rendering. Strong knowledge of materials in Unreal. Proven ability to collaborate with supervisors, artists, and production teams. Preferred Qualifications: Traditional art background or fine arts education. Experience with look development and the compositing process (especially in Nuke). Familiarity with scripting or tool development (e.g., Python, MEL) to support pipeline enhancements. Experience working across both stylized and photorealistic CG projects.
